Delayed si Jhemerlyn Rose explores the nuanced tension of young adulthood. It’s a raw look at 18-year-old Jhemerlyn as she navigates a situation that feels both monumental and painfully relatable. The pacing can feel deliberate, mirroring her internal struggle and attempts to manage an unplanned crisis. There’s a certain authenticity in the performances, especially the chemistry between Jhemerlyn and Jogbert, which adds to the film's intimate atmosphere. The practical effects here aren't flashy, but they serve the story well, drawing you into the reality of her emotional experience. It’s distinctive for its focus on a single moment in time, capturing that anxiety and uncertainty that comes with growing up. A quiet film that resonates in subtle ways.
